¿ä¾à2 This study was carried out to utilize and to develope the combination adhesive from PF(Phenol formaldehyde adhesive) and TCA(Trichloroacetic acid)-precipitated blood powder for the manufacture of plywood. The results were as following; 1)In dry tensile shear strength of plywood, 100parts of PF (solid content: 20%) added 15parts and 20parts of TCA-precipitated blood powder, 100parts of PF (solid content: 10%) added 25parts of TCA-precipitated blood powder, and UF control showed best value They didn ¡¯ t show the statistical difference. 2)In boil tensile shear strength of plywood, all combination adhesives met the KS standard of boil test. PF(solid content : 20%) added TCA-precipitated blood powder and PF(solid content: 50%) added wood flour filler didn¡®t show the statistical difference. 3)In the test of formaldehyde emission, the difusion rate of formaldehyde of all PF-blood combination adhesives showed below 0.5 ppm and met the E-O grade of JIS(Japanese In- dustrial Standard).
